ACI, Atalla debut teller system.

To help reduce paperwork and boost security, a personal identification number terminal, developed by Atalla Corp., San Jose, Calif., can be programmed with Omaha-based Applied Communications Inc. software, allowing customers to identify themselves by swiping their bank card through the terminal and entering their PIN. Once identified, a customer can request transactions without having to fill out deposit slips or other paper forms.
